On my face that took literally 8 minutes:

  • Skin. You're gonna die, but I used two of the foundation samples I ripped out of one of my magazines (that I was reading around 2:30am) for Maybelline's new Dream Smooth Mousse foundation ($8)(for normal to dry skin- ME!). I mixed color creamy natural and natural beige from the sample card (bc one wasn't enough for my whole face) and slapped it on my face with my finger. This stuff blended awesome-ly and looked pretty darn flawless to have come preserved in my magazine. I'm definitely buying this stuff.
  • Eyes. My favorite neutral goldish-brown-camel color shadow right now, Lancome's Color Design shadow in color Chic ($17). Lancome has some of the best pigmented shadows in my opinion. This neutral is definitely worth the price tag- I wear it a lot. Mascara was Lancome's Hypnose in color black ($24.50), and yes, I took time for 2 coats on top and bottom. Lots of lashes are a must when skipping eyeliner!
Neutral inspiration on runways along with my brush pointing to my "Chic" shadow color
  • Cheeks. Nars blush in Orgasm ($25). is there really any other blush choice out there??
  • Lips. Mirror Mirror Lip Gloss in "I'm Perfect" by Too Faced. This is a wonderful sheer beige tinted colored gloss that looks about as sexy as beige can get for the a.m. school drop off hour!
